26.3 percent of people 25 or older have an associate's degree or higher in Pryor Creek
26.3 percent of people 25 years or older had an associate's degree or higher in Pryor Creek in 2020, according to data obtained from the U.S. Census Bureau.

Census Bureau: More men than women in Pryor Creek in 2020
Of the 9,417 people living in Pryor Creek in 2020, 50 percent (4,705) were women and 50 percent (4,712) were men, according to U.S. Census Bureau data obtained by the NE Oklahoma News.

Census Bureau: 75.3 percent of people in Pryor Creek were old enough to vote in 2020
Of the 9,417 citizens living in Pryor Creek in 2020, 7,087 were old enough to vote as of March 26, according to U.S. Census Bureau data.

Census Bureau: 10.6% of people in Pryor Creek identified as multi-racial in 2020
Of the 9,417 citizens living in Pryor Creek in 2020, 89.4 percent said they were only one race, while 10.6 percent said they were two or more races, according to U.S. Census Bureau data obtained in March.

Census Bureau reports Pryor Creek population was 9,417 in 2020
Pryor Creek had a population of 9,417 people in 2020, according to U.S. Census Bureau data obtained by the NE Oklahoma News.
